Layout financing is a kind of temporary loan that is paid off in 30 to 90 days, the time it generally requires to offer an automobile. A regular brand-new auto sets you back a supplier concerning $5 to $10 in rate of interest per day. So if a car rests on the lot for 30 days, the supplier will be billed $150 - $300 in interest settlements.
The majority of producers compensate these financing prices via what is called "". This is typically 2 - 3% of the invoice rate of the car. On a typical $28,000 cars and truck, a 2% holdback would amount to around $550. If the supplier sells this cars and truck in thirty days and sustains funding costs of $300, then they will certainly make a profit of $250 on the holdback.

, cars and truck dealers have traditionally been an essential source of state and neighborhood sales tax obligations. By 2010, all US states had laws that prohibited suppliers from side-stepping independent auto dealerships and selling cars straight to consumers.Economists have actually characterized these laws as a kind of rent-seeking that extracts rental fees from makers of vehicles, increases expenses for consumers, and restrictions access of brand-new cars and truck dealerships while elevating revenues for incumbent car dealerships. marhoffer nissan. Research reveals that as an outcome of these legislations, market prices for vehicles are higher than they otherwise would be
Today, straight sales by an automaker to consumers are restricted by most states in the United state through franchise legislations that require new cars to be marketed just by accredited and bound, independently owned car dealerships.
In feedback, Tesla has opened city centre galleries where possible clients can see vehicles that can just be bought online. These stores were motivated by the Apple Shops. Tesla's version was the very first of its kind, and has actually provided unique benefits as a new car firm. nissan. In economic concept, automobile dealerships can be defined as franchisees and automobile suppliers as franchisors.

The franchisor can act opportunistically by enforcing restraints and problem on the franchisee after the last has actually sustained sunk costs, such as investing in physical possessions and accumulating a credibility with clients. The franchisor can for instance call for that vehicles be cost affordable price, and services be carried out for little payment.Auto dealerships have lobbied for regulations that increase the survival and earnings of auto dealers: By 2010, all US states had regulations that banned manufacturers from side-stepping independent vehicle dealerships and offering cars and trucks to customers straight. By 2009, most states enforced constraints on the production of brand-new dealers to contend with incumbent dealerships.

Many state legislations need upon the discontinuation of a car dealership that manufacturers redeem the stock, and unique tools and in many cases pay the lease of the dealer's facilities. The issuance of brand-new dealer licenses can be subject to geographical constraint; if there is currently a dealer for a company in an area, no one else can open up one.

In the European Union, cars and truck makers were permitted from 1985 to 2006 to participate in agreements with car dealers that limited what type of automobiles dealers were allowed to market. Cars and truck makers were able "to impose qualitative, measurable and geographical limitations on supply by offering their vehicles just with a restricted variety of dealerships bound by strict franchise business contracts." In 2006, the European Commission determined that it was anti-competitive for auto makers to restrict suppliers from bring multiple cars and truck brands.Net use has actually motivated this niche service to expand and get to the basic consumer industry.
